Your experience will obviously differ according to the personalities of the CDs involved. For our part, we have often encountered the CD onboard in one or another of the lounges or in port and the more sociable ones have always seemed to welcome an opportunity to socialize with passengers, answer questions and accept suggestions. On one cruise, we actually convinced the CD to reverse her decision not to have a horse auction (the event had been poorly attended on the previous few cruises) and on our cruise the horses actually sold for a minimum of $400 each with strong and spirited bidding by many parties. Another cruise director came to our Meet and Mingle and regaled us with fascinating backstage stories of some of his experiences on the ship. There have also been a few CDs that we saw little of except when he or she was onstage, and still others we would have liked to see and hear less of. It's all a matter of personality, and it should also be pointed out that the duties of a cruise director involve much more than emceeing the shows or overseeing some of the onboard activities, and some of those duties require his work to be done out of public view and behind the scenes.
